Publication policy

The Finnish Environment Institute (Syke) promotes high-quality and open publishing in both scientific and professional contexts. Our publications adhere to good scientific practices, and funding sources are openly disclosed.

Diverse and impactful publishing

Syke's research results and expertise are presented through various publication channels, such as peer-reviewed journals, professional publications, and blogs. Syke encourages its researchers to actively communicate about their publications and participate in societal discussions on different platforms, such as conferences, media, and social media.

Open access publishing

Syke supports open access publishing and promotes broad accessibility of research data. Scientific articles are parallel-archived for open access in Syke's Helda publication repository in the most finalized form possible.

Commitment to high-quality publications

Syke actively participates in high-quality co-publishing. The publication activities emphasize peer-reviewed articles and other high-quality publications that appear in edited series, journals, and books.
